May 16, 2006....about 4:30 in the afternoon, it's raining as we approach the entrance to AK. It's my first time on EE...I am more than a bit nervous, don't like heights, don't particularly like rollar coasters, but I am giving in to severe peer pressure.....very sad to see in a 56 y/o woman. Anyway....by the time the park closed, at 6:00, I had ridden EE 14 times, in rapid succession. Yep, I loved it. We got to EE, got on with about a 10 minute wait...must have been due to the lateness of the hour and the drizzle. We just kept getting off, charging through the preride area, hopping back on. Got to ride in the front car on my third trip. On the last run, they finally shut the attraction door behind us...last ones on. We had an entire section of car to ourselves!!!
Everyone should try it at least once!!! |

I was very nervous about this ride but ended up loving it. You go fast, and backwards, and at one point its hard to tell if you are going upside down (I was told we were not). I loved it and we rode it 3 times in one day. Get there right when the park opens, and also grab a fast pass at that time. We also rode again at the end of the day with a pretty short line, I think only 15 minutes. My kids, 12 & 14, rated it as their favorite ride of all. In fact, everyone we talked to loved the ride, and we had an older couple by us in line one time (probably late 60s) and after the ride they said they loved it, too. It doesnt bump you around too much, its really great.
